Anti-Hamas protests expected

Friday, 9 January 2009 12:00 AM

By Ian Dunt

Anti-Hamas protests are expected over the weekend in London, with a large rally planned for Trafalgar Square on Sunday.

The protest, which is designed to counter vociferous demonstrations by pro-Palestinian groups, is being organised by the Board of Deputies of British Jews and the Jewish Leadership Council.

"We ask all London Jewry to attend the rally in Trafalgar Square this Sunday to express their fervent wish that Hamas terror should end so that there will be peace for all the innocent people in the region," said Simon Hochhauser, president of the United Synagogue.

The protest will begin around 11:00 GMT.

It is designed to coincide with a protest in Manchester at the same time on Sunday, which will take place in Albert Square.

The protest follows violence outside the Israeli embassy in west London on Wednesday night, when pro-Israel groups clashed with Palestinian solidarity campaigners.
